"The invention is a portable irrigation device that can dispense water or other liquid chemicals to plants. It is designed to be easily attached to a container, such as a water bottle or soft drink can, and can be operated without supervision. The device uses a dispensing unit and a control unit to activate or deactivate the dispensing unit. It can release the liquid chemicals at a steady rate and is designed to be flexible and easy to install. The device is simple and inexpensive to manufacture and can be programmed to operate according to specific irrigation cycles. Its performance is not affected by the type of liquid chemical used and it can be used with readily available containers."

Problems solved by technology

Automatic apparatus is expensive and water consuming and is not adapted individually to irrigate plants, as it is always conceived to irrigate broad areas of vegetable growth.
Hand operated apparatus may be inexpensive, but is awkward to use and is wasteful and inefficient in the irrigation of individual plants, as it generates streams or broad sprays of water which always spread the water over large areas.
Water is applied only to those areas where it is needed, that is, it is dripped onto the soil above a root zone, and therefore only a relatively small amount is wasted.
Even though the technology is simple, drip irrigation requires careful maintenance of equipment since the emitters can become easily clogged.
Economic considerations therefore preclude, or restrict, the use of portable irrigation devices which are based on a drip irrigation system.
Although such an irrigation device is economical, the delivery rate of irrigation liquid is not controllable, and therefore an inordinate amount of liquid is improperly utilized.

[0044] The present invention relates to an unattended portable irrigation device which dispenses a controllable dose of irrigation liquid from a sealed container by means of bursts of air delivered into the container, which force the irrigation liquid to be discharged from the container via a conduit disposed therein.

[0045]FIG. 1 illustrates an exemplary irrigation device according to the present invention, and is generally indicated at 1. Irrigation device 1 comprises dispensing unit 5, container 10 threadedly enageable therewith, conduit 12 in fluid communication with the container and with the dispensing unit, discharge tube 30, and a control unit, which is schematically designated by numeral 35 and is illustrated in FIG. 9. Container 10, which is preferably a standard transparent or translucent bottle for soft drinks, as shown, having a volume of e.g. one or two liters, is partially filled with irrigation liquid as indicated at 11. Abstract

The invention provides a portable irrigation device for dispensing irrigation liquid from a container to a target plant holder substrate area. The device comprises a dispensing unit which is releasably attached to the container, a control unit for activating or deactivating the dispensing unit, and a discharge tube in fluid communication with the dispensing unit through which discharged irrigation flows. Irrigation liquid is discharged from the container as a result of pressurized air which is generated by said control unit and injected into the container.
